1 Steel strength as defined in AISC Manual of Steel Construction 2nd Ed. (LRFD):
Yield = Fy x Tensile Stress Area
Tensile = 0.75 x Fu x Nominal Area
Shear = 0.45 x Fu x Nominal Area

Samples of the HVU Resin were immersed in the various chemical compounds
for up to one year. At the end of the test period, the samples were analyzed.
Any samples showing no visible damage and having less than a 25% reduction
in bending (flexural) strength were classified as Resistant. Samples that had
slight damage, such as small cracks, chips, etc. or reduction in bending
strength of 25% or more, were classified as Partially Resistant. Samples that
were heavily damaged or destroyed were classified as Not Resistant.
